If you are using full motion real estate video productions to promote your properties, your area, your brand you have learned the ears are just as important as the pair of eyeballs.

maine fisherman Talking one on one to the real estate buyer and seller helps support, fill in the spaces on what they are scanning with their eyeballs.

Audio is 40% of the real estate video experience.

Connection, making a solid relationship with your on line viewer, listener is key as that real estate buyer and seller look around the global village to find a professional to link up with, to help them with their questions, needs.

Audio, your voice, sounds from your listing, your area makes that outside buyer feel like they are in your backyard.

Using an external mic and as much natural footage as you can gather is the key to create a video user postive experience that is powerful, memorable and that delivers a punch.

Windy days, rainy weather all impact the final outcome of your shoot, edit, upload video experience.
